The PEAK Conference
Influencer Marketing in Endurance Sports

For Influencers: Thursday 21st April 2016 | 7-9PM | London

The Crystal, Royal Victoria Docks, E16 1GB (a short walk from London Marathon Expo)

Our PEAK Conferences are an opportunity for influencers, marketers and senior managers working in endurance and outdoors sports to come together, discuss and learn more about the current and future landscape of influencers marketing in our sector.

The PEAK conference is brought to you by Freestak, the endurance sports network. At this event we will explore the key trends in influencer marketing in the endurance sport sector and you will learn how to increase your reach and work with the brands you love. Our PEAK conference will also see the launch the FreestakPulse report into influencer marketing based on an extensive survey of brands and influencers. Attendees will be the first to see the results of that survey.

  • Explore the latest trends in influencer marketing including the things that brands are looking for from influencers;
  • Learn how to enhance your power and work with brands you love;
  • Meet other bloggers and influencers in the industry and share ideas and experience.

THE 7 DEADLY SINS OF INFLUENCER MARKETING

In a world where social has become the new gold rush, brands are increasingly looking to work with influencers. Michael will look at the deadly sins of working with brands; you’ll hear how to fit into a brands’ marketing strategy, how to maximise what they get from working with you and how to ensure both parties get what they are looking for from the relationship.


WHAT I HAVE LEARNED FROM WORKING WITH BRANDS

Driven by her philosophy “One day I will not be able to do this. Today is not that day”, Sophie challenges herself both physically and mentally. Amongst many challenges, Sophie is the only person in history to have climbed the highest mountains in the eight Alpine countries and cycled between them. Sophie will talk about how she brings brands along for the ride, sharing the stories she creates and bringing value to her audiences and to the brands she works with.


SOCIAL MEDIA STRATEGIES FOR BLOGGERS AND INFLUENCERS

Bloggers and influencers have a lot of scope to use social media to promote their blogs and personal brands, and this talk will help experienced bloggers take their strategy to the next level. From strategy audits and best practices to partnerships and monitoring performance, attendees will learn how to hone their strategies for the best results.


THE STATE OF INFLUENCER MARKETING IN ENDURANCE SPORTS

We will present the findings of our 2016 PULSE survey about Influencer Marketing in Endurance Sports.


Our first conference will be held on Thursday 21st April 2016 at The Crystal, Royal Victoria Dock . The Crystal is the world’s most sustainable conference centre and can be found a short walk from the London Marathon Expo at ExCel.

From 7pm-9pm the Freestak team will host a series of presentations, panel interviews, discussions and networking opportunities around the current state of Influencer Marketing. The conference will feature some superb guests including leading Influencers, Bloggers, Brand Managers and experts in Digital Communication and will be followed by drinks and networking.
